Wood siding repair services involve assessing and restoring the exterior wooden surfaces of a property to ensure they remain durable and visually appealing. This process typically includes replacing damaged or rotted wood, fixing cracks or gaps, and addressing any structural issues that may compromise the siding's integrity. Skilled contractors can also perform surface repairs, sanding, and sealing to protect the wood from future damage caused by moisture, pests, or weather exposure. Proper repair work helps extend the lifespan of wood siding while maintaining the home's overall appearance.
Many common problems that lead homeowners to seek wood siding repair include rot, warping, cracking, or insect damage. Over time, exposure to rain, humidity, and temperature fluctuations can cause wood to deteriorate or develop unsightly cracks. Additionally, pests such as termites can compromise the structural soundness of wooden siding, leading to the need for repairs.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, reduce the risk of costly replacements, and preserve the home's value and curb appeal.
Wood siding repair services are often utilized on residential properties, including single-family homes, historic houses, and multi-unit buildings with wooden exteriors. These properties typically feature traditional or rustic architectural styles, where wood siding contributes significantly to the overall look. Homeowners who notice signs of damage or deterioration, such as peeling paint, soft spots, or visible cracks, may find that repair services are an effective way to restore their siding’s function and appearance without the need for complete replacement.

The overview below groups typical Wood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Shelton,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ood siding repairs in Shelton, CT often range from $250 to $600, covering tasks like patching or replacing small sections.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and material type.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Moderate Repairs - For more extensive repairs involving multiple sections or replacing damaged panels, local contractors may char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homes needing partial siding restoration or addressing weather-related damage.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ding replacement projects in Shelton typically cost between $3,000 and $8,000, depending on the size of the home and siding material choices. Larger or more complex homes can push costs higher, sometimes exceeding $10,000.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more intricate jobs, such as custom designs or historic home restorations,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ve specialized work that increases overall cost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my wood siding needs repairs? Signs such as rotting, cracking, warping, or insect damage indicate that wood siding may require professional repair services.
What types of damage can local contractors fix on wood siding? They can address issues like rot, cracks, peeling paint, insect infestations, and general wear and tear.
Are there different repair options for various types of wood siding? Yes, repair methods can vary depending on the siding material, including options like patching, replacing damaged boards, or refinishing.
What should I consider when choosing a contractor for wood siding repair? Look for experienced local service providers with good reputations who can assess the damage accurately and recommend suitable repair solutions.
Can repair work help extend the lifespan of my wood siding? Proper repairs can improve the appearance and integrity of wood siding, potentially extending its useful life when performed by skilled contractors.
